For someone like me, who will be in need of a LOT of icons as projects move on, it will save you a lot of work and time. You can focus on other things, like making icons for those who can't do it themselves, working on quests of your own, and most importantly... playing HeroQuest!

I've already tested out a large room icon and it worked out well. Just need to simplify it some to keep the file size down. For me, that seems to be the trickiest part. Keeping them simple, yet appearing detailed enough to be recognisable.
